Fragments bound to bovine trypsin for the SAMPL challenge

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 19822883

About this Structure

4abh is a 1 chain structure of Trypsin with sequence from Bos taurus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.

See Also

Reference

  • Newman J, Fazio VJ, Caradoc-Davies TT, Branson K, Peat TS. Practical aspects of the SAMPL challenge: providing an extensive experimental data set for the modeling community. J Biomol Screen. 2009 Dec;14(10):1245-50. Epub . PMID:19822883 doi:10.1177/1087057109348220
